implemented rolling friction, using a contact constraint. Useful to get rolling spheres to rest, even on a slightly sloped plane.
See http://www.youtube.com/watch?v=RV7sBAsKu4M and Bullet/Demos/RollingFrictionDemo Fixes in FractureDemo (mouse picking constraint needs to be removed, otherwise constraint solver crashes/asserts)
